Few D.C. United players hold affection for the Black-and-Red in the same manner as Stephen King. A local product who started every game of his four-year University of Maryland career (93 matches), King is renowned for his work ethic on the pitch, and he is deeply loyal to the club. Since joining United in April of 2010, King has been one of the team?s most reliable contributors. The central midfielder has played 31 MLS matches for the Black-and-Red (22 starts), registering one goal and one assist in 1,930 minutes of action.
